Innovation in Central Bank Digital Currencies

Validated Project

According to recent research from the Atlantic Council Tracker, the majority of the world’s Central Banks are seriously considering Central Bank Digital Currencies, with many projects already underway.

While the facts indicate that planning for and testing of digital forms of national currency are underway, actual implementation often lags behind due to lack of experience, understanding of use cases and specific applications.

In order to foster innovation and drive the development of CBDC applications, Ripple sponsored a CBDC Innovate Challenge in 2022. Enterprise and individual developers were encouraged to enter the challenge and develop CBDC applications using Ripple’s technology, in three categories:

  • Retail
  • Interoperability
  • Financial Inclusion

The CBDC Innovate Challenge closed with a total of six winners (two from each category) at the end of 2022. The enthusiasm among developers surrounding the challenge was strong and Ripple received almost 500 entries.

CBDCs are Ideal for Innovation

Well-designed CBDCs, backed by the safety of Central Bank Reserves and country regulations, offer not only a secure and reliable means of performing digital transactions, they can also help to solve some of the world’s biggest challenges including financial inclusion and sustainability.

With CBDCs, payments can be accelerated, banking and third-party transaction fees can be lowered and the environmental burdens of printing fiat currency—using paper and significant energy resources—can be eliminated.

Jose Jesus Perez Aguinaga, conFIEL founder and CBDC Innovate winner highlights how CBDCs can be a stable, beneficial, and positive force for people around the world, stating that “with the adequate technology and controls in place, CBDCs can actually bring financial freedom to individuals.”

For the Innovate Challenge, conFIEL developed a unique localized application, designed to be used by the Central Bank of Mexico. conFIEL explored building a retail CBDC on top of the XRP Ledger for Mexico’s Central Bank (Banxico) using SAT (Mexican tax authority) digital signatures called FIEL (or e.Firma). The use of the digital signatures verifies the identity of the users, thereby helping to prevent fraud and theft.

conFIEL is just one of the winning CBDC Innovate projects showcasing how CBDCs can be used to promote financial inclusion and fast, accelerated payments.

CBDC Payment and Interoperability Apps

Two other specific entities to highlight from the CBDC Innovate Challenge include SpendTheBits and Checksum. Both applications provide a solution to enable CBDCs to work as a functional bridge between other digital assets.

“CBDCs hold great potential to revolutionize finance with impacts such as financial inclusion, reduced friction, near-instant settlement times, interoperability, and integration with enterprise and retail applications,” says SpendTheBits founder Jay Kambo, who conceptualized the project by leveraging a central bank monetary framework and perspective.

SpendTheBits (STB) is an application that allows retail users to make payments in multiple currencies including CBDCs, cryptocurrencies, and stablecoins. With SpendTheBits secure, interoperable payments can be made in seconds rather than days. The SpendTheBits application incorporates a CBDC Portal, the STB Mobile and Merchant App, and STB Exchange Portal to allow interoperability and liquidity.

Checksum, developed by whirledlabs, specifically takes on a business-facing perspective with advanced payment features and user interface that enables enterprises to easily process checks, invoices, expenses, and payroll for B2B CBDC management. A New Way to Fund Loans Using Digital Currency

The P2P Loans app (aka P2P-CBDC) offers the capability to provide loans for anyone with an XRP Ledger account. P2P CBDC is decentralized, open-source, fast, simple, and low-cost, making it accessible to anyone around the world.

Chris Winkler, creator of P2P-CBDC shared his thought process in formulating his app: “For the 2022 CBDC Innovate challenge, we combined the unmet needs of people that don’t have access to financial services—like loans—with the global development of fast, secure and more accessible CBDCs. That’s when the fusion of our idea of P2P-loans with CBDCs on the XRP Ledger was born. The XRPL and its outstanding technology enables us to empower people to transform their lives by providing them with the exact financial services they need.”

  • Securitize raises $47M in funding led by BlackRock to enhance innovation and expansion in digital asset securities ecosystem

    Miami-based company Securitize, which specializes in tokenizing real-world assets, has raised $47 million in funding. The round was led by BlackRock, with participation from Hamilton Lane, ParaFi Capital, Tradeweb Markets, Aptos Labs, Circle, and Paxos. The funds will be used to enhance the company's innovation and expansion as it consolidates its position in the digital asset securities ecosystem. BlackRock's first tokenized fund, the BlackRock USD Institutional Digital Liquidity Fund, has also been launched on Ethereum and is available to investors by subscribing to the fund with Securitize.

  • On-chain content distribution agreement Metale Protocol completes additional $2 million in seed round financing

    Metale Protocol, a content distribution protocol on the blockchain, announced the completion of an additional $2 million seed round of financing. Waterdrip Capital led the investment, with participation from Aipollo Investment and Ultiverse. As of now, the total size of its seed round financing has reached $4 million. Metale Protocol was formerly known as Read2N, a Web3 decentralized reading application. The new funds will be allocated to its content creation fund to stimulate more content creation activities and promote the construction of its protocol as a platform for issuing and distributing content assets on the blockchain.
